Handy Hints For A Problem Free Family Vacation |

We wait all year for the great family getaway only for it to turn into a complete disaster! Follow these tips to ensure your vacation is enjoyable for all.
Protection from the Sun
We all know that you don’t having to be lying on the beach or by the pool to get sunburnt; so if you and your family are going to be outside at theme parks take along sufficient sun protection with an SPF 30 or higher. Apply frequently and don’t forget ears and noses.
Take it Easy
You may be on holiday for a short period so it may be tempting to jam as much as possible into your trip. It is important to schedule some relaxation time into your trip; otherwise the kids can feel overwhelmed. Some downtime will leave the family refreshed and raring to go for the next activity.
Healthy Eating
Being on vacation isn’t an excuse to avoid healthy eating. It is important that the kids eat well-balanced meals and snacks, including fruit and vegetables; this will eliminate irritable and hyperactive children.
Be Comfortable
If your trip includes lots of walking, forget those sexy summer sandals and opt for a well fitting trainer with cotton socks which will absorb perspiration and provide protection against blisters.
Preparation is Key
No one wants to be ill on vacation but anything can happen. Take along a First Aid kit that includes band aids, bandages, anti-bacterial wipes, sting ointment, fever reducer, thermometer and a doctor’s phone number. Since the kids will be open to new environments and foods you should also include an antihistamine, such as Benadryl, to treat those unanticipated allergic reactions.
Schedule
With all the excitement of being on vacation the kids will no doubt want to stay awake a little longer. However, try and keep sleeping times as closely as possible to your normal home life. You never know, the added activity and fresh air may increase the need for some shut-eye!
